[Cu(1,5-nds)(H2O)4]n (I), [Cu(H2O)6](1,5-nds) (II) (1,5-nds = 1,5-naphthalenedisulfonate) and [Cd(p-NH2C6H4SO3)2] (III) can react with primary alkyl amine vapors and form stable monoamine-coordinated Cu(II) and Cd(II) complexes.
